一、JS的数据类型和变量
- 5种数据类型:
String 字符型;
number 基本数据类型(short、int、long)
boolean 布尔型
funtion 函数
object 对象
- 3种特殊的值:
undefind:未定义,所有js里未赋予初始值的时候。默认为undefind
null :空值
NAN : not a number ,不是数字,也不是数值;
string 类型 * 数值类型 不会报错,但是输出会是NAN
- 关系运算
== :等于是简单字面值的比较
===:全等于,除了做值的比较,还做数值类型的比较
- 逻辑运算:
- 数组
函数
在JAVA中函数允许重载,在Js中重载会覆盖掉上一次的定义;
隐形参数:
二、JS中Object自定义对象!
2、花括号形式{}定义对象
三、Js事件!
常用事件:
onload 加载完成的事件
onclick 单击事件
onblur 失去焦点事件
onchange 内容发生改变事件
onsubmit 表单提交事件